Selection for
Construction Management |
| This major accepts freshman applications for the
Fall Quarter only. |
| |
| Freshman applicants compete to
be selected only against other freshman applicants applying
for the same major through a point-based evaluation of three
academic categories and one non-academic category. The four
categories are weighted differently for different colleges/majors
and combine to provide a final result used in conjunction
with other applicants applying for that major. |

Section one - College prep GPA
|
| |
Calculated by Cal Poly for 9th -11th grade coursework
designated on the application (with honors points granted for
courses designated as "honors" on a high school transcript,
for up to eight semesters.) |

Section three - ACT or SAT I
test scores |
| |
Please note |
| 1. |
Only ACT or SAT I scores are used in the selection
process. (more
information) |
| 2. |
If you are applying for the Fall Quarter, scores
from ACT or SAT tests taken after November are not guaranteed
to be used in the selection process. |

Section four - Work experience
and extra-curricular activity participation |
| |
This information is taken from only four questions |
| 1. |
Average number of hours worked per week over the
most recent 12 months? |
| 2. |
Was more than 25% of your work related to your
Cal Poly choice of major? (yes or no) |
| 3. |
Average number of hours per week involved in community
service, arts, clubs, and other extra-curricular activities
during the last 12 months? |
| 4. |
Do you hold or have you held any leadership positions
in the activities from question #3 (examples include Senior
Class President, Yearbook Editor, etc.)? |
|
This is the only information taken concerning extra-curricular
activities and work experience. Personal essays, letters of
recommendation, and statements of purpose are not used during
the admissions selection process.
The information for all four sections comes from the supplemental
information obtained by the CSUMentor
online application.
